Eric Davis

Creative Director & Senior Editor at Institute for Corporate Productivity

Eric Davis has a diverse work experience in various industries. Eric started their career in 1996 as an Information Representative Manager at the Robert C. Byrd Institute for Advanced Flexible Manufacturing. Eric then worked as an Advertising Designer at Cox Target Media from 1997 to 2006. In 2005, they started their own consulting company called EJ Davis Consulting, where they served as the VP and Co-Owner until 2007. Eric joined the Institute for Corporate Productivity (i4cp) in 2006, initially as a Researcher and then taking on roles such as Senior Analyst/Writer and Associate Editor. Eric'sresponsibilities at i4cp included writing research reports, articles, blogs, and press releases, as well as providing thought leadership on HR and workforce productivity issues. Currently, Eric is the Creative Director & Senior Editor at i4cp, responsible for designing and producing research assets and developing new products for different media outlets. Eric also edits, writes, and proofs various materials for both internal and external publications.

Eric Davis (he/him/his) attended Marshall University from 1991 to 1997, where they obtained a Master of Arts degree in Journalism and Mass Communication with a concentration in PR & Advertising.
